18VAC10-20-210: Requirements for licensure as a professional engineer

In general, the required education will be applied as follows:

EDUCATIONAL REQUIREMENTS

PASSING OF FUNDAMENTALS EXAM REQUIRED?

NUMBER OF REQUIRED YEARS OF QUALIFYING ENGINEERING EXPERIENCE

1. Have graduated from an ABET- accredited undergraduate engineering program.

YES

4

2. Dual degree holders.

a. Have graduated from an ABET-accredited undergraduate engineering program; and

b. Have graduated from a doctorate engineering program that is ABET accredited at the undergraduate level.

NO

4

3. Have graduated from a four-year related science program, engineering technology program, or a non-ABET-accredited engineering program.

YES

6

4. Have obtained, by documented academic coursework, the equivalent of education that meets the requirements of ABET accreditation for the baccalaureate engineering technology. Whether an education is considered to be equivalent will be determined by the judgment of the board.

YES

10

5. Have graduated from an engineering, engineering technology, or related science curriculum of four years or more.

NO

20
